Output 76c9158a3f507f784394db25b672297e25c662346fe290d8aa16e6fc3f40d82c:4

value
21204
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c58066997f1f5191aa1febc8a3e6c54ffc215ee24bbfb15e09a4010edcd77f4d
address
tb1pckqxdxtlrager2sla0y28ek9fl7zzhhzfwlmzhsf5sqsahxh0axsy6fmh3
transaction
76c9158a3f507f784394db25b672297e25c662346fe290d8aa16e6fc3f40d82c
confirmations
22479
spent
true